Main purpose of the job/apprenticeship:

To meet customers’ requirements and present as the “professional” in customer support to both internal & external customers & suppliers for the safe and efficient transport of cargo effectively and in accordance with company operational procedures and statutory requirements including Health & Safety

Some of the Key Tasks of a Customer Service Specialist:

You will be given training and support to enable you to be fully proficient in the below:

  • Communicate effectively in a professional manner with customers & suppliers.
  • Receive jobs, review for accuracy & allocate to service providers.
  • Ensure legislative compliance in all areas including customs declarations.
  • Validate shipment routing against operating procedures and guidelines (exports).
  • Confirm departure (exports) .
  • Arrange collection from carriers and onward delivery to customer (imports) & monitor proof of delivery.
  • Ensure that the company operates within all agreed operational procedures, and within statutory requirements including the provision and maintenance of a safe working environment.
  • Communicate efficiently and effectively (via use of PC's, fax machines, telephone, etc.) with internal and external customers, suppliers, and other offices, as required by operational procedures.
  • In conjunction with others, plan collection or deliveries.
  • Proactive support of Customer Service teams.
  • Liaise with external suppliers to monitor job progress.
  • Irregularity handling and escalation as appropriate to

next level (Team Leader or Manager)
